Current Conditions
Sunny
Temperature: 25 degrees F
Dew Point: 3 degrees F
Wind Speed: 12 MPH
Wind Direction: NW
Humidity: 31%

Beautiful sunny day for today's weather.  Temperatures will continue to rise throughout the day most likely topping off around the mid to low thirties.  Winds coming out of the northwest make it seem a little colder then 25 degrees, but the constant sun is counteracting that.  Cloud cover is minimal with a few high cirrus clouds.  Weather across the country is relatively the same with high pressure systems to our west and a stationary front still sitting over the Rocky Mountains.  Winds coming from the northwest will bring a patch of precipitation currently sitting over the middle of Canada our way tonight and there is a slim chance that we could see a few snow showers overnight.  After that possible snowfall tonight we should see more clear conditions for the rest of the week with temperatures continuing to rise.  Below are the current weather, wind, and water vapor maps.
